I recently purchased a Kia Sorento and I want to make sure I am properly maintaining the tires for the best performance. What are some recommended steps for maintaining the tires on my Kia Sorento?
ReplyHello Samantha, congratulations on your new Kia Sorento! The best way to maintain your tires is by regularly checking the tire pressure, rotating the tires every 5,000 to 7,000 miles, and ensuring they are properly aligned. Make sure to also visually inspect the tread depth and look for any signs of damage. And don't forget to periodically clean your tires to prevent buildup of dirt and debris.
